Transaction 63342667975f684324eaf41792c1b837b2582fa328955c990bd37a911b7d484b
1 Input
1 Output
-
63342667975f684324eaf41792c1b837b2582fa328955c990bd37a911b7d484b:0
- value
- 324001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11d0515470594c76beda0c9c82c2a738b6c90cb6 OP_EQUAL
- address
- 33KCxyLDfFfovNdF4o21wg7yvKr7kGhrGn